ContributorCommunity HistoryDescriptionPhotograph taken at the Dreamtime Event at Mount Flora Museum in 2018. This was the first time there had been a Welcome to Country and an Aboriginal blessing ceremony had been conducted at this site. As part of the celebrations, a painting that depicted the of hands of staff and attendees was made, to symbolise the coming together of the community to acknowledge the Nyoongar people as the traditional custodians of Mount Flora. It was also organised as part of the Museum's 30th anniversary celebrations.CollectionMooro culture and heritage collectionDate created2018
